WebBuild Futures is a not for profit organization serving homeless and at risk youth ages 18 to 24 in Orange County. It is an innovative collaborative program that connects these youth with housing ... WebBuilding Futures creates permanent supportive housing in neighborhoods throughout the city for low-income families living with HIV/AIDS and other disabilities, including those who were homeless or precariously housed. WebFeb 14, 2024 · Building four consecutive homes with four accessory dwelling units (ADUs) on four empty lots is a first for the Housing First Minnesota Foundation, Minnesota Assistance Council for Veterans (MACV), and Lennar partnership. Construction on the first two homes started in the fall of 2024.
